Bay burglary alert

Police have warned residents in Richards Bay to be alert after several business and residential burglaries were reported

A SPIKE in burglaries at residential and business premises in Richards Bay is becoming a concern for police.

Richards Bay SAPS spokesperson, Captain Debbie Ferreira, says several burglaries have been reported recently where criminals used forced entry to gain access to premises.

In Mzingazi, suspects broke down a homestead door at Mabuyakhulu Cottages around 2am last Wednesday, threatened the women with sticks and stole cell phones and a laptop.

In Richards Bay burglaries were reported in Tassel Berry Road in Arboretum, Corral Shower in Veldenvlei and Dollar Drive in the central business district.

Ferreira added that incidents of theft out of motor vehicles was still a major problem and urged motorists not to leave valuables in their vehicles.

‘Theft out of motor vehicles is a crime that can be averted and we ask the public to be wary of leaving items in the boot or inside the vehicles,’ she said.
